We describe and present a general class of synchronous nonlinear increase-decrease algorithms which can be applied in any situation in which a limited resource has to be distributed amongst a group of users. No inter-agent communication is required and the algorithms are provably convergent. This work unifies and generalises a number of recent papers on this topic.
